Q1.What are the typical costs for a traditional funeral service at a Hampden, ME funeral home?

In Hampden, the average cost for a traditional funeral service with viewing, burial, and a basic casket typically ranges from $7,000 to $10,000. This includes the funeral home's basic services fee, preparation of the body, and use of facilities. Costs can vary based on the specific funeral home and selections made, so it's important to request a detailed price list, which Maine law requires funeral homes to provide.

Q2.Are there any local Hampden cemeteries that work directly with funeral homes for burials?

Yes, Hampden funeral homes commonly coordinate with local cemeteries such as Locust Grove Cemetery and Lakeview Cemetery for burial services. They handle the necessary arrangements, including securing the plot, opening and closing the grave, and obtaining any required permits from the Town of Hampden. Some families also choose cemeteries in nearby Bangor or Winterport, which local funeral homes can also facilitate.

Q3.What should I know about Maine's regulations for cremation services in Hampden?

Maine requires a 48-hour waiting period after death before cremation can proceed, and a cremation authorization form must be signed by the next-of-kin. In Hampden, funeral homes will help you complete this paperwork and arrange for the cremation, which often takes place at a regional crematory. They can also advise on local options for scattering ashes, as Maine law allows scattering on private property with permission and on most uninhabited public lands.

Q4.How can I pre-plan a funeral with a Hampden funeral home, and are there state-specific benefits?

Most Hampden funeral homes offer pre-planning services where you can make arrangements and lock in current prices. In Maine, you can fund a pre-paid funeral plan through a trust or insurance, which is protected under state law. This can help ease the burden on your family and ensure your wishes are known, including any preferences for services at local churches or venues in the Hampden area.

Understanding what to look for in a Hampden funeral home can help you make a confident choice. First, consider proximity and familiarity. A local funeral home understands our community's traditions, values, and the unique character of life in Penobscot County. They often have established relationships with local cemeteries, churches, and venues, which can simplify logistics during a stressful time. Visiting a few funeral homes in person, if possible, allows you to sense the atmosphere and meet the staff who will be caring for your family.

When evaluating funeral homes near you in Hampden, ask about the range of services they offer. Today, families have more options than ever, from traditional funeral services with viewings to more contemporary celebrations of life, direct cremations, or green burials. A good funeral director will listen to your family's wishes, your budget, and the personality of your loved one to help create a meaningful tribute. They should provide clear, upfront pricing and explain all available options without pressure.

Personal connection matters deeply. You'll want a funeral director and staff who communicate with empathy, patience, and respect. They should be willing to accommodate special requests, whether that involves incorporating military honors for a veteran, creating a display of personal memorabilia, or helping plan a unique service that truly reflects your loved one's life. In a small community like ours, many families appreciate working with professionals who may already be familiar faces.

Practical considerations are also important. Look at the facilities themselves—are they well-maintained, accessible, and able to accommodate the size of gathering you anticipate? Consider whether the funeral home offers grief support resources or can connect you with local counselors and support groups in the Hampden area. Many families find ongoing support invaluable in the weeks and months following a service.
